Each year, my groups are always most excited about using the dry erase boards with markers. We use our boards for random comprehension checks, stop and jots, and most times the children just like to draw and writes notes to me. Dry markers and boards are a hot commodity in my room. Each Friday, my students take an assessment on the weeks lessons, using the privacy partitions will give my students the opportunity to show growth and understanding of the strategies learned, in their own space. My students are noticeably more engaged in their work and less disruptive of their peers when they are given their own space.
